We have been doing the "no shopping for groceries", experiment for 2 weeks now. We did take the weekend off of our anniversary to go to NM. But, still no grocery shopping.
This is what I have been experiencing. I have to cook a lot more. I am much more creative. I do not waste a thing. I make sure things will last longer. I spread the snacks out more knowing I cannot shop. It has made me more aware of food and waste.
Doug has noticed the money he saves. He no longer eats out everyday, he now makes his lunch and snacks to eat during the day.
We have saved a lot of money not shopping. We do miss dairy queen frosties and potato chips. I have stuff here to make cookies, pies, etc. But again, no CHIPS - I don't buy chips very often but now that they are not in the house we seem to want them more. Go figure. It's amazing what we can find to eat in the house though. I search more now for what I need in my own home instead of the isles of Walmart.
It's been interesting to do this experiement, but so far it's not been really difficult. We still have two more weeks in our experiment, we shall see how that goes.
